I found it on SW website

Serves: 4
Prep time:
Cook time:
Syns per serving:
· Green: 5
· Original: 2
· Extra Easy: 2
Add 6 Syns if not using Chicken (raw weight) as a Healthy Extra on Green.
3 tbsp honey
3 tbsp balsamic vinegar
3 tbsp soy sauce
680g chicken breasts, cut into 1" cubes
1. Mix together the honey, vinegar and soy sauce. Toss the chicken cubes in the mix to coat thoroughly, and leave to stand for at least 30 minutes in the fridge.
2. Heat a frying pan, add the chicken cubes and marinade. Cook on a high heat for about 20 minutes, until all the liquid has absorbed into the chicken. Stir regularly to prevent burning.
3. When the chicken is thoroughly cooked, serve immediately on a bed of crispy salad#

So so tasty and would be really good as a base fir stirfry. Really quick to make too. Thanks for this. However if making DON'T add any salt as the soy sauce reduces and makes it salty enough.
